#261da6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#261da6 is composed of 14.9% red, 11.4% green and 65.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.1% cyan, 82.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 243.9 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 38.2%. #261da6 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c3aff with #00004d.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#261da6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040310 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#261da6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616163 is the less saturated color, while #1207bd is the most saturated one.
